.s-image-text-3{background:#1a3c34;border-radius:18px;margin-bottom:20px}@media screen and (min-width: 1024px){.s-image-text-3{background:rgba(0,0,0,0);border-radius:0;margin-bottom:0}}.s-image-text-3--rtl{direction:rtl}.s-image-text-3__inner{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:35px;padding:0 21px}@media screen and (min-width: 1024px){.s-image-text-3__inner{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;padding:0 4.86vw;gap:10vw}.s-image-text-3__inner--reverse{-webkit-box-orient:horizontal;-webkit-box-direction:re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se}}@media screen and (min-width: 1580px){.s-image-text-3__inner{max-width:1440px;padding:0;margin:0 auto;gap:144px}}.s-image-text-3__image{width:100%;-ms-flex-negative:0;flex-shrink:0}@media screen and (min-width: 1024px){.s-image-text-3__image{max-width:55%}}.s-image-text-3__image img{width:100%;-o-object-fit:cover;object-fit:cover}.s-image-text-3__text-container{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.s-image-text-3__title{color:#fff;font-family:var(--font-heading);font-style:normal;font-weight:400;line-height:94.444%;letter-spacing:-1.62px;text-transform:uppercase;margin:0;margin-bottom:34px}@media screen and (min-width: 1024px){.s-image-text-3__title{color:#1a3c34}}.s-image-text-3__subtitle{color:#a68f6b;font-family:var(--font-heading);font-style:italic;font-weight:400;line-height:268.421%;letter-spacing:1.33px;margin:0;margin-bottom:14px}.s-image-text-3__text{color:#fff;font-family:var(--font-body);font-style:normal;font-weight:400;line-height:127.778%;letter-spacing:1.26px}@media screen and (min-width: 1024px){.s-image-text-3__text{color:#1a3c34}}.s-image-text-3__text *{margin:0}.s-image-text-3__text a{color:#c89211}.s-image-text-3__link{display:block;color:#1a3c34;text-decoration:none;font-style:normal;font-weight:400;line-height:48px;font-size:16px;border:1px solid #fff;background:#fff;-webkit-transition:all 200ms ease;transition:all 200ms ease;padding:0 36px;margin-top:38px}@media screen and (min-width: 1024px){.s-image-text-3__link{color:#1a3c34;border:1px solid #1a3c34;background:rgba(0,0,0,0)}.s-image-text-3__link:hover{color:#fff;background:#1a3c34}}